Meaning & usage
A visit to consult somebody, such as a doctor; a consultation.
The act of consulting or deliberating; consultation.
The result of consultation; determination; decision.
A council; a meeting for consultation.
Agreement; concert.
Where this word comes from
From Middle French consulter, from Latin cōnsultum, from cōnsultus, from cōnsulō.
To seek the opinion or advice of another; to take counsel; to deliberate together; to confer; to advise.
To advise or offer expertise.
To work as a consultant or contractor rather than as a full-time employee of a firm.
To ask advice of; to seek the opinion of (a person)
To refer to (something) for information.
To have reference to, in judging or acting; to have regard to; to consider; as, to consult one's wishes.
To deliberate upon; to take for.
To bring about by counsel or contrivance; to devise; to contrive.
